| import gradio as gr |
| from transformers import AutoModel |
| from PIL import Image |
| import torch |
| import torch.nn.functional as F |
| import requests |
| from io import BytesIO |
|
|
| |
| model = AutoModel.from_pretrained('jinaai/jina-clip-v1', trust_remote_code=True) |
|
|
| def compute_similarity(image, text): |
| image = Image.fromarray(image) |
|
|
| with torch.no_grad(): |
| |
| text_embeds = model.encode_text([text]) |
| image_embeds = model.encode_image([image]) |
|
|
| |
| similarity_score = (text_embeds @ image_embeds.T).item() |
|
|
| return similarity_score |
|
|
| |
| demo = gr.Interface( |
| fn=compute_similarity, |
| inputs=[gr.Image(type="numpy"), gr.Textbox(label="Enter text")], |
| outputs=gr.Number(label="Similarity Score"), |
| title="JinaAI CLIP Image-Text Similarity", |
| description="Upload an image and enter a text prompt to get the similarity score." |
| ) |
|
|
| demo.launch() |
